WVP-PRO国标视频平台架构深度解析:从标准协议到企业级部署实战
【免费下载链接】wvp-GB28181-pro基于GB28181-2016、部标808、部标1078标准实现的开箱即用的网络视频平台。自带管理页面,支持NAT穿透,支持海康、大华、宇视等品牌的IPC、NVR接入。支持国标级联,支持将普通摄像机/直播流/直播推流转国标共享到国标平台。项目地址: https://gitcode.com/GitHub_Trending/wv/wvp-GB28181-pro
在视频监控技术快速演进的今天,企业面临着设备异构、协议多样、平台孤岛等多重挑战。WVP-PRO作为一款基于GB28181-2016、部标808、部标1078标准的开源视频平台,通过创新的技术架构设计,为这些痛点提供了系统性的解决方案。本文将从技术架构、核心能力、部署实践三个维度,深度解析WVP-PRO如何构建现代化视频监控体系。
技术架构演进:从协议兼容到智能流控
传统视频监控系统往往受限于厂商专有协议,形成数据孤岛。WVP-PRO采用分层解耦的架构设计,将信令处理、媒体流转发、设备管理和前端展示分离,实现了协议兼容性与系统扩展性的平衡。
信令处理层基于SIP协议栈实现GB28181标准通信,支持UDP/TCP双模式传输,确保在复杂网络环境下的稳定连接。这一层负责设备注册、目录查询、云台控制等核心信令交互,采用异步非阻塞设计应对高并发场景。
媒体流转发层与ZLMediaKit深度集成,支持RTSP、RTMP、HTTP-FLV、WebSocket-FLV、HLS等多种流媒体协议。智能流控机制通过"无人观看自动断流"技术,在无用户观看时自动切断流媒体传输,显著降低带宽占用。
设备管理层提供统一的设备抽象接口,兼容海康、大华、宇视等主流品牌设备,支持NAT穿透技术,实现跨网络环境的设备接入。
前端展示层基于Vue.js构建响应式管理界面,支持多画面分屏监控、GIS地图集成、实时报警推送等功能。
国标级联配置界面展示SIP服务器参数配置,实现平台间互联互通
核心能力拆解:四大技术支柱支撑企业级应用
国标协议深度适配
WVP-PRO对GB28181-2016标准的完整实现,确保了与各类国标设备的无缝对接。平台支持设备注册、目录订阅、实时点播、云台控制、录像回放等标准功能,同时扩展了设备状态监控、报警事件处理等增强特性。
协议兼容性对比表: | 协议类型 | 支持功能 | 应用场景 | |---------|---------|---------| | GB28181-2016 | 完整信令交互、媒体流控制 | 国标设备接入、平台级联 | | 部标808 | 车辆定位、状态监控 | 车载视频监控 | | 部标1078 | 音视频传输、报警处理 | 道路运输监控 |
多级平台互联架构
级联功能是WVP-PRO的核心优势之一。平台支持向上级平台进行级联连接,构建统一的监控网络体系。通过SIP协议完成身份认证,实现跨平台的通道状态订阅和实时监控。
平台级联监控界面展示上级平台与设备状态,实现跨平台统一管理
级联配置关键技术参数:
- SIP服务国标编码:唯一标识平台身份
- 信令传输模式:UDP/TCP双模式支持
- 心跳保活机制:确保连接稳定性
- 通道选择策略:支持按行政区划或业务分组推送
智能媒体流处理引擎
媒体流处理性能直接影响用户体验。WVP-PRO通过以下技术优化确保高质量视频传输:
# 媒体节点配置示例 media_server: rtmp_port: 1935 rtsp_port: 554 http_port: 80 https_port: 443 hook_ip: 127.0.0.1 sdp_ip: ${server_ip} stream_ip: ${server_ip} port_mode: single # 支持single/multi模式流媒体性能优化策略:
- 自适应码率调整:根据网络状况动态调整视频质量
- 智能缓存机制:减少网络抖动对播放的影响
- 多协议输出:同一视频源支持多种播放协议
- 硬件加速支持:利用GPU进行视频编解码
企业级运维监控体系
运维监控是保障系统稳定运行的关键。WVP-PRO提供全面的监控功能,包括系统资源监控、设备状态跟踪、报警事件处理等。
平台监控界面展示设备在线率、通道流量、资源使用等多维度统计信息
实施路径规划:从环境准备到生产部署
环境配置最佳实践
部署WVP-PRO需要考虑硬件资源、网络环境和软件依赖三个维度。以下是推荐的配置方案:
硬件资源配置建议: | 并发路数 | CPU核心数 | 内存 | 存储 | 网络带宽 | |---------|----------|------|------|----------| | 50路以下 | 4核 | 8GB | 100GB | 100Mbps | | 50-200路 | 8核 | 16GB | 500GB | 1Gbps | | 200路以上 | 16核+ | 32GB+ | 1TB+ | 多网卡绑定 |
数据库配置优化:
-- MySQL性能优化参数 SET GLOBAL innodb_buffer_pool_size = 2G; SET GLOBAL innodb_log_file_size = 256M; SET GLOBAL max_connections = 500; SET GLOBAL thread_cache_size = 32;部署架构选择策略
根据业务规模和可用性要求,WVP-PRO支持多种部署架构:
单节点部署:适合中小规模应用,所有组件部署在同一服务器,简化运维但存在单点故障风险。
分布式部署:将信令服务、媒体服务、数据库分离部署,支持水平扩展,适合大规模应用场景。
高可用集群:通过负载均衡和数据库主从复制实现高可用,确保业务连续性。
安全配置深度指南
安全是视频监控系统的生命线。WVP-PRO提供多层次安全防护:
网络层安全:
- 防火墙策略配置,仅开放必要端口
- VLAN隔离,将视频流量与业务流量分离
- VPN隧道,确保跨网络传输安全
应用层安全:
- 用户身份认证与权限控制
- API接口访问控制
- 视频流加密传输
- 操作日志审计
多画面分屏监控界面支持实时视频预览,提供直观的设备状态监控
扩展应用场景:从基础监控到智能分析
智慧城市视频联网
在智慧城市项目中,WVP-PRO可以作为视频汇聚平台,整合各部门监控资源。通过国标级联功能,实现市、区、街道三级平台互联,构建统一的视频监控网络。
关键技术实现:
- 多级平台级联:支持行政层级间的视频资源共享
- 权限分级管理:按行政级别分配视频访问权限
- 视频质量保障:智能码率调整适应不同网络环境
企业园区安防管理
对于企业园区场景,WVP-PRO提供灵活的权限管理和设备分组功能。支持按部门、楼宇、区域进行设备分组,实现精细化的访问控制。
业务分组管理界面支持按企业组织架构管理设备,实现权限精细控制
企业级特性:
- 设备分组管理:支持多级分组结构
- 用户权限体系:基于角色的访问控制
- 操作日志审计:完整记录用户操作行为
- 报警联动处理:支持报警事件自动响应
交通监控系统集成
结合部标808和1078标准,WVP-PRO可以构建完整的交通监控解决方案。支持车载视频监控、车辆定位跟踪、报警事件处理等功能。
交通监控特色功能:
- 实时位置监控:GPS/北斗定位数据集成
- 行驶状态分析:速度、方向、状态监测
- 报警事件处理:超速、疲劳驾驶等报警
- 视频录像回放:支持按时间、位置检索
性能调优与故障排查实战
性能瓶颈识别与优化
视频监控系统的性能瓶颈通常出现在网络带宽、CPU处理能力和存储IO三个方面。WVP-PRO提供以下优化策略:
网络带宽优化:
- 启用智能流控,无人观看时自动断流
- 配置多端口模式,提升并发连接数
- 使用UDP传输,减少TCP握手开销
CPU负载优化:
- 硬件加速编解码,降低CPU占用
- 合理配置线程池大小
- 监控系统资源使用,及时扩容
存储性能优化:
- 使用SSD存储提升IO性能
- 配置合理的录像保留策略
- 分布式存储架构,避免单点瓶颈
常见故障排查指南
设备无法注册:
- 检查网络连通性,确保设备与平台网络互通
- 验证SIP配置参数,包括国标编码、密码、端口
- 检查防火墙设置,确保5060端口开放
- 查看平台日志,分析具体错误信息
视频播放卡顿:
- 检查网络带宽是否充足
- 调整视频码率和分辨率
- 启用硬件加速功能
- 优化媒体服务器配置参数
级联连接失败:
- 验证上级平台配置参数
- 检查网络NAT穿越配置
- 确认证书和认证信息
- 查看信令交互日志
运维信息界面展示系统硬件配置、软件版本等关键信息,辅助故障排查
技术选型决策框架
评估维度与指标
选择视频监控平台时,需要从多个维度进行评估:
协议兼容性:是否支持GB28181、部标808/1078等标准协议扩展能力:是否支持平台级联、设备扩展、功能定制性能表现:最大并发路数、延迟、资源占用率运维复杂度:部署难度、监控能力、故障恢复时间成本效益:硬件要求、授权费用、维护成本
与传统方案对比
| 对比项 | 传统监控平台 | WVP-PRO |
|---|---|---|
| 协议兼容 | 厂商专有协议 | 国标+部标标准协议 |
| 扩展性 | 有限,依赖厂商 | 开源,可深度定制 |
| 部署成本 | 高昂的授权费用 | 开源免费 |
| 运维复杂度 | 厂商锁定,难以自主维护 | 开源社区支持,自主可控 |
| 集成能力 | 封闭系统,集成困难 | 开放API,易于集成 |
未来技术演进方向
随着AI和边缘计算技术的发展,视频监控平台正在向智能化演进。WVP-PRO的技术架构为未来集成以下功能提供了良好基础:
AI视频分析:集成人脸识别、行为分析、车辆识别等AI算法边缘计算:在设备端进行初步视频分析,减少云端压力云边协同:边缘计算与云计算协同工作,提升系统效率5G融合:利用5G网络特性,实现超高清视频传输
总结:构建现代化视频监控体系的技术路径
WVP-PRO通过标准协议兼容、分层架构设计、智能流控机制等技术创新,为企业构建现代化视频监控体系提供了完整解决方案。平台不仅解决了设备兼容性和平台互联的痛点,还通过开源模式降低了技术门槛和部署成本。
在实际部署过程中,建议遵循"先试点后推广"的原则,从小规模部署开始,逐步验证系统稳定性和功能完整性。同时,建立完善的监控体系和应急预案,确保系统7×24小时稳定运行。
随着视频监控技术的不断发展,WVP-PRO的开放架构和活跃社区为技术演进提供了持续动力。无论是智慧城市建设、企业安防管理还是交通监控应用,WVP-PRO都能提供坚实的技术支撑,助力企业构建高效、智能、可靠的视频监控体系。
设备管理界面展示设备列表和国标联网配置,支持多品牌设备统一管理
【免费下载链接】wvp-GB28181-pro基于GB28181-2016、部标808、部标1078标准实现的开箱即用的网络视频平台。自带管理页面,支持NAT穿透,支持海康、大华、宇视等品牌的IPC、NVR接入。支持国标级联,支持将普通摄像机/直播流/直播推流转国标共享到国标平台。项目地址: https://gitcode.com/GitHub_Trending/wv/wvp-GB28181-pro
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考